Kotoko�s troublesome yet prolific striker, Ahmed Toure, whose absence in Kumasi attracted hundreds of questions on his whereabouts has finally touched base in Kumasi to join his colleagues for the second round of the 2011/12 season.
The player was given two weeks compassion leave to go and visit his sick mother in his native country, La Cote d�Ivoire, about a month ago but he reneged on meeting his return date.
Calls went to him whilst away and he kept postponing his return date.
This caused a lot of apprehension and concern among Kotoko supporters who got worried about the absence of their darling player as the team got ready for the second round of the season.
Speaking to asantekotokosc.com, Toure assured all that he is back and that he was willing and ready to play his heart out to compensate fans and the team for his long absence.
